Compare performance (313 HP vs 180 HP), boot space and price (30,100 £ vs 33,400 £ ) at a glance. Find out which car is the better choice for you – MINI Countryman or Peugeot Expert Bus?
Price and efficiency are often the first things buyers look at. Here it becomes clear which model has the long-term edge – whether at the pump, the plug, or in purchase price.
MINI Countryman is moderately cheaper – starting at 30,100 £ , while the Peugeot Expert Bus costs 33,400 £ . That’s a price difference of around 3,283 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the MINI Countryman uses 5.9 L/100km and is slightly more efficient than the Peugeot Expert Bus with 6.9 L/100km. The difference is about 1 L/100km.
Power, torque and acceleration say a lot about how a car feels on the road. This is where you see which model delivers more driving dynamics.
When it comes to engine power, the MINI Countryman offers significantly more power – delivering 313 HP compared to 180 HP. That’s roughly 133 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the MINI Countryman is significantly quicker – completing the sprint in 5.6 s, while the Peugeot Expert Bus takes 10.6 s. That’s about 5 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the MINI Countryman delivers slightly more torque with 494 Nm compared to 400 Nm. That’s about 94 Nm more.
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.
Seats: Peugeot Expert Bus offers more seats – 9 vs 5.
In terms of curb weight, MINI Countryman is markedly lighter – 1,570 kg compared to 1,998 kg. The difference is around 428 kg.
Looking at boot space, the Peugeot Expert Bus offers significantly more boot space – 3,497 L compared to 505 L. That’s a difference of about 2,992 L.
When it comes to payload, the Peugeot Expert Bus carries considerably more – 942 kg compared to 500 kg. That’s a difference of about 442 kg.
The MINI Countryman stands well ahead of its rival in the objective data comparison.

The MINI Countryman turns the cheeky charm of a classic MINI into a proper all-rounder, blending playful styling with surprisingly usable space for everyday life. It still grins at city lights but will happily tackle muddy lanes, perfect for buyers who want character without sacrificing practicality.
detailsThe Peugeot Expert Bus is a sensible people-mover that pairs commercial durability with a surprisingly comfy interior, making it ideal for shuttle duty or large-family road trips. It won’t steal any style prizes, but its practical layout, easy-driving manners and thoughtful kit mean you’ll spend more time moving people and less time fussing over details.
